Computer Information Systems at Walden University
Walden University is located in Minneapolis, Minnesota and has a total student population of 49,695. Of the 1,729 students who graduated with a bachelor’s degree from Walden University in 2021, 30 of them were computer information systems majors.

In 2021, 46 students received their master’s degree in CIS from Walden University. This makes it the #90 most popular school for CIS master’s degree candidates in the country.
There were 28 students who received their doctoral degrees in CIS, making the school the #8 most popular school in the United States for this category of students.
Earnings of Walden University CIS Graduates
The median salary of CIS students who receive their bachelor's degree at Walden University is $54,093. This is great news for graduates of the program, since this figure is 2% higher than the national average of $53,242 for all CIS bachelor's degree recipients.

Walden University Computer Information Systems Master’s Program
In the CIS master's program at this school, racial-ethnic minorities make up 61% of degree recipients. That is 25% better than the national average.*
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ity for students who recently graduated from Walden University with a master's in CIS.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 8 |
Black or African American | 16 |
Hispanic or Latino | 2 |
White | 11 |
International Students | 2 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 7 |
Walden University also has a doctoral program available in CIS. In 2021, 28 students graduated with a doctor's degree in this field.
